Clearwater Campground is located along the Buffalo Bill Scenic Byway, about 32 miles west of Cody, in northwestern Wyoming. It is 20 miles east of the east entrance to Yellowstone National Park. The surrounding area offers many outdoor recreational opportunities, including fishing, hiking and viewing local wildlife.The campground offers one group camping area, which provides private parking, three large picnic tables, two food storage lockers and campfire circle.

Small 12-site tent campground on the Buffalo Bill Scenic Byway with excellent hiking, fishing, and wildlife viewing opportunities. Located conveniently between Cody and Yellowstone's east entrance with spacious, private sites and incredible views.
Wildlife alert: Grizzly Bear, Moose, American Bison, North American River Otter, and Mule Deer present in area. Bear boxes provided at campground.
Insider tips for Clearwater Campground: Book early - this is a popular federal campground Camp host provides knowledgeable bear safety advice and wildlife warnings Firewood available for purchase on-site
Skip Clearwater Campground if: You need RV hookups - no hookups available. You prefer year-round camping - seasonal operations only. You want solitude and minimal host interaction - camp host actively engages with campers.

From Cody, Wyo., follow Sheridan Avenue west through Cody until the road leaves town, and becomes the Buffalo Bill Cody Scenic Byway (U.S. Highway 14/16/20). The campground is 32 miles west of Cody, on the south side of the highway and next to the river.
